728x90 반응형 SMALL image5 [AWS] 도커 컨테이너 nginx 배포 디렉토리 생성 docker 디렉토리에서 nginxtest 디렉토리를 생성한다. mkdir nginxtestcd nginxtest/ Dockerfile 생성 nginx를 foreground에서 실행하기 위해 CMD에 -g와 daemon off;를 추가한다. 컨테이너가 background로 실행되므로, nginx를 foreground에서 돌리지 않으면 nginx가 exited된다. vim DockerfileFROM nginx:1.26.0CMD ["nginx", "-g", "daemon off;"] 도커 이미지 빌드 docker image build . -t mynginx01 빌드된 이미지를 확인한다. docker image ls 컨테이너 실행 ocker container run -d mynginx01d.. 2024. 6. 11. [AWS] 도커 설치 도커 설치 sudo apt-get updatesudo apt-get install ca-certificates curlsudo install -m 0755 -d /etc/apt/keyringssudo curl -fsSL https://download.docker.com/linux/ubuntu/gpg -o /etc/apt/keyrings/docker.ascsudo chmod a+r /etc/apt/keyrings/docker.ascecho \ "deb [arch=$(dpkg --print-architecture) signed-by=/etc/apt/keyrings/docker.asc] https://download.docker.com/linux/ubuntu \ $(. /etc/os-release && ech.. 2024. 5. 30. [Data Engineering] 도커 (Docker) 도커 (Docker) 신뢰할 수 있는 데이터 인프라 구축과 중복된 작업을 피하기 위해 데이터 엔지니어링은 필수이다. 모든 어플리케이션 및 패키징, 종속된 라이브러리를 어느 환경에서나 개발하기 위해서 쉽게 배포하고 안정적으로 구동할 수 있게 도와주는 도커를 사용한다. Dockerfile Dockerfile은 지정된 이미지를 빌드하는 데 필요한 모든 명령을 순서대로 나열한 텍스트 파일이다. Dockerfile은 Docker 빌드 명령에 의해 Docker 이미지를 생성하는 데 사용된다. Image 이미지는 읽기 전용이며 변경되지 않는다. Docker 이미지는 코드, 런타임, 라이브러리, 환경 변수, 구성 파일 등 소프트웨어를 실행하는 데 필요한 모든 것을 포함하는 경량의 독립 실행형 실행 패키지다. Conta.. 2024. 1. 22. [eXplainable AI] XAI method : LIME LIME LIME (Local Interpretable Model-agnostic Explanations)은 블랙박스 ML 모델의 개별 예측을 설명하는 데 쓰이는 해석 가능한 (interpretable) 모델이다. Surrogate Model Surrogate란, 본래 기능을 흉내내는 대체재를 만들어 프로토타입이 동작하는지 판단하는 분석 방법이다. XAI에서도 원래 AI 모델이 너무 복잡하여, 연산적인 제약으로 분석이 불가할 때 유사한 기능을 흉내내는 AI 모델 여러 개를 만들어 분석하는 것을 말한다. 분석해야 하는 모델을 f라고 할 때, 이를 흉내내는 모델 g를 만드는 것이 surrogate 분석이다. 이때 모델 g의 학습 방식은 f와 같을 수도, 다를 수도 있다. 모델 g의 조건 - 모델 f보다 학습.. 2022. 2. 10. [Computer Vision] 이미지 다루기 이미지 읽기 cv2.imread (fileName, flag) 함수를 이용하여 이미지 파일을 읽는다. 이미지 파일의 경로는 절대 / 상대 경로가 설정할 수 있다. import cv2 img = cv2.imread('xx.jpg', cv2.IMREAD_COLOR) # read xx.jpg ◦ parameters: fileName (str) – 이미지 파일의 경로, flag (int) – 이미지 파일을 읽을 때의 option ◦ returns: image 객체 행렬 ◦ return type : numpy.ndarray ◦ cv2.IMREAD_COLOR : 이미지 파일을 color로 읽음. 투명한 부분은 무시되며, default 값 ◦ cv2.IMREAD_GRAYSCALE : 이미지를 grayscale로 읽음.. 2021. 12. 21. 이전 1 다음 728x90 반응형 LIST